Summary: | A capacitance charger transfers the primary coil voltage into secondary coil voltage by a transformer, in which a charging end is used to charge the capacitance element to attain a preset voltage, and a capacitance voltage sensor and method are used to detect the capacitance element voltage. Wherein a voltage-divider or a sensing current flowing through the resistance element is used to generates a feedback signal so that the capacitance charger stops charging as long as the voltage of the capacitance element is equal to or larger than the preset voltage and prevents backflow current from the capacitance element to the charging end. Therefore, the capacitance element is capable of avoiding possible electric leakage from the sensor device. |
